Luca’s Italian Restaurant celebrates 27 years of family dining

Luca’s Italian Restaurant is inspired by a home-cooked feeling, where the kitchen is the heart of the home.

Luca’s Italian Restaurant was established in 1994 and captures the essence of the Italian lifestyle – colourful and flavour-filled.

They honour centuries-old traditions essential to authentic Italian cuisine – simplicity and passion.

Their grand wood-burning oven, which uses specialised refractory brick and mortar, is designed to deliver even heat throughout the dome. Built single-handedly by Signor Guido, a perfectionist Italian artisan, it delivers pizzas, pasta and other dishes in an authentic manner that is certain to delight the gods.  

Slow-food specialities, including Osso Buco rabbit casserole, served with polenta and the most unusual lamb, pot-roasted in coffee and apricots (Mamma Alma’s recipe), will have you coming back for more.

Their comprehensive menu promises you the ultimate Italian food experience. The extensive menu goes hand-in-hand with a collection of carefully selected fine South African and Italian wines to complement your choice of meal.

Winter months are made cosy with gas heaters and in the summer, you can enjoy warm afternoon lunches and lingering evening dinners outside under magnificent London Plane trees.
